TriplePoint Venture Growth BDC Corp. (the “Company”) (NYSE:TPVG) today
announced that it has priced its initial public offering of 8,333,333
shares of common stock at $15.00 per share for total gross proceeds of
approximately $125.0 million. In addition, the Company has granted the
underwriters a 30-day option to purchase up to 1,250,000 additional
shares of its common stock. Immediately prior to pricing of the
offering, the Company acquired its initial portfolio of assets for
approximately $121.7 million in cash. The Company intends to use all of
the net proceeds from the offering and a concurrent private placement
together with borrowings under the Company’s credit facility to pay the
outstanding balance on the bridge loan it incurred in order to acquire
its initial portfolio. The Company’s shares are expected to begin
trading on the New York Stock Exchange on March 6, 2014, under the
symbol “TPVG.” The closing of the offering is subject to customary
closing conditions, and the shares are expected to be delivered on or
about March 11, 2014.
Morgan Stanley & Co. LLC, Wells Fargo Securities, LLC, Goldman, Sachs &
Co., Credit Suisse Securities (USA) LLC and UBS Securities LLC are
acting as joint book-running managers for the offering.

About TriplePoint Venture Growth BDC Corp.
TriplePoint Venture Growth BDC Corp. (the “Company”) is an externally
managed, closed-end, non-diversified management investment company that
has elected to be regulated as a business development company under the
Investment Company Act of 1940, as amended. It was formed to expand the
venture growth stage business segment of its sponsor, TriplePoint
Capital LLC ("TriplePoint Capital"). The Company’s investment objective
is to maximize its total return to stockholders primarily in the form of
current income and, to a lesser extent, capital appreciation by
primarily lending with warrants to venture growth stage companies
focused in technology, life sciences and other high growth industries
backed by a select group of leading venture capital investors.
